我知道how to apply conditional formatting if there are duplicate values in a column和I know how to use a formula to that references values from multiple sheets;但是,我想要做的是将格式应用于值,如果它在另一个工作表中是重复的。
示例:我有工作表"友谊赛","医疗保健"," IT"和#34;营销"包含姓名和联系信息。电子邮件地址始终位于E列。
偶尔会有人从垂直医疗保健中转移到友情表中。
当有人被添加到friendlies工作表时,我希望友情表中的电子邮件单元格(在E列中)变为红色,以提醒我将其从医疗保健表中删除。
是否可以创建一个公式,以查找另一个工作表的副本?我尝试了以下没有运气:
= countif(医疗保健!E:E,E1)> 1 ,以及 = countif(医疗保健!E:医疗保健!E,E1 )> 1 然后终于 = countif(医疗保健!E:医疗保健!E,医疗保健!E1)> 1
有没有人有任何见解可以提供帮助?
答案 0 :(得分:0)
据推测,与安全性相关,跨表格的条件格式化可能有点严峻,但如果您准备使用辅助列,则CF公式规则非常简单。
采用与您尝试过的方法类似的方法,帮助列,比如说F
,应该填充,比如F1,然后向下复制以适应:
=countif(healthcare!E:E,E1)+countif(IT!E:E,E1)+countif(marketing!E:E,E1)
然后只需选择friendlies
中的ColumnE和格式 - 条件格式......,自定义公式为:
=F1>0
选择红色格式并选择完成。
辅助列的替代方法是应用命名范围和INDIRECT:
=countif(indirect("hMail"),E1)+countif(indirect("imail"),E1)+countif(indirect("mMail"),E1)
hMail
例如healthcare
中的ColumnE名称。